Bocas del Toro
A cacao growing region in Panama.
Panamafruityfloralacidic
A Caribbean province of Panama and effectively the whole of its cacao production, grown largely by Ngäbe-Buglé farmers on small shaded plots with organic certification widespread.

Terroir
High-rainfall Caribbean lowland and islands, with cacao under shade among plantain and timber.
Flavour character
Often described as fruity and floral with brisk acidity.
InferredSource: ChocolateHQ
Based on a small number of speciality lots rather than the province's output as a whole.
